Robert, First and foremost if you wish to scroll a window then why not use the TIX.ScrolledWindow widget instead. It even shows and hides the scrollbar when necessary.
#-- Start Script --# from Tix import * #from Tkconstants import * class App(Tk): # Must use Tk for Tix incompability def __init__(self): Tk.__init__(self) self._createWidgets() def _createWidgets(self): swin = ScrolledWindow(self, width=400, height=300) swin.pack(fill=BOTH, expand=1) frame = swin.window col, row = 0,0 for row in range(100): for col in range(3): w=Button(frame, text='This is button (%02d, %02d)' % (col, row)) w.grid(row=row, column=col) col += 1 row += 1 if __name__ == '__main__': app = App() app.mainloop() #-- End Script --# -- http://mail.python.org/mailman/listinfo/python-list
